NotesORIGINALLY RELEASED IN 1959, Miles Davis' magnum opus Kind of Blue is still considered by any to be one of the greatest albums of all time. Starring Davis, John Coltrane, Cannonball Adderley, Bill Evans, Wynton Kelly, Paul Chambers, and Jimmy Cobb, Kind of Blue has held onto it's status as an album that crosses genres, speaks to generations, and is one of the first (if not the first) album that any new jazz acolyte purchases. Kind of Blue 50th Anniversary Legacy Edition offers the complete studio sessions on 2 CDs, including false starts, alternate takes and a 17-minute 1960 live version of "So What." the Legacy Edition exposes a new generation to Miles Davis and places this historic event in context offering over 2 hours of audio that illustrates how this unparalleled ensemble evolved; plus never-before- heard session talk; and accompanying liner notes rich with detail, written specifically for the golden anniversary.

  • Historic Music

    I have been listening to this music since it was first released in 1959 when I was a senior in high school. Although I have listened to this music all through the years I have always enjoyed this music no matter where jazz has gone. Besides Miles' playing it is Adderly's playing that has stayed with me. It took me awhile to realize why and what it was that was in his playing that always drew me back. When you compare the different players it is Adderly's "bluesiness" that is the draw. I noticed that in Wynton Kelly's playing as well that "bluesiness" that also drew me back but Kelly is only on one track "Freddie Freeloader" a blues tune. Bill Evan's was the pianist on the other tracks and who adlibbed the intro to "So What". This was and is an historic album that was recorded in that "church" that Columbia recorded other famous albums in the late 1950s.
